We stayed in the quad at the Santa Chiara a few years ago. It was a 2 room suite with 1 bathroom. The kids had a room with 2 twin, and we had a room with 1 large bed. I believe there was also a small refridgerator in the room. It was clean and comfortable and the breakfast was great. I do remember the shower stall being tiny.

I can't compare to the others.

MFNYC Dec 9th, 2005 10:57 AM

I just wanted to add, being a family of 4, having 2 bathrooms which would be the case with the 2 doubles, may be a plus for you. We were OK with 1, but 2 would have been nice.
